Handover: SproutClock scheduler

From: Dario → To: Lena (security review prep)

SproutClock computes watering windows from the greenhouse sensor feed and pushes schedules to the valve controllers. Auth between services uses short-lived tokens rotated hourly; the rotation job lives in the same pod. No external ingress except the admin panel, which sits behind the office VPN. For the review, the relevant runtime configuration values are listed below.

service settings:
PRAIX_LOG_LEVEL=error
PRAIX_METRICS_HOST=metrics.praix.qorvelcorp.corp
PRAIX_POOL_SIZE=16

Handover — intern arrivals, Brindlework HQ. Tove: fourteen interns land Monday, 09:00, Atrium East. Lanyards are in the cabinet behind reception. Walk them through fire exits first, then desks on floor three. Kitchen briefing can wait. Don't let anyone onto floor four unescorted. They'll need the temporary pass to get through the stairwell door, so use the one below.

badge for fafop-fajof: bdg-Z-47

## Deployment

Tollgate's payment retry worker depends on idempotency keys to guarantee that a retried charge never settles twice. During deployment, roll the workers one at a time so in-flight keys remain resolvable against the shared key store; a full restart can orphan keys mid-window and force manual reconciliation. Verify the key TTL exceeds the longest plausible retry horizon before promoting, and confirm the store's eviction policy in staging first. The deployment-relevant settings are reproduced below.

deployment values, kajep-kageg:
[praix]
host = praix.paliqcorp.corp
user = praix_svc
database = praix_prod